I ordered a high end computer with very specific, brand name products to be installed. I received the computer and immediately noticed the power supply was the wrong one. I pulled off the side cover to check out the rest of the components. I found the wrong hard drives, power supply, System RAM, missing system detector, the wrong network card, the wrong card reader, the built in 802.11g wireless was not configured and the wrong cables were installed.
In all it is conservative to say that I was cheated out of more than $600 worth of parts by them installing inferior parts or not installing parts at all that we had agreed to in writing.
When I informed them I hadn't received the proper computer per my order they told me I had now voided the warranty by opening up the case thereby cheating me out of a 3 year warranty.
The computer crashed all of the time and Windows Advanced Diagnostics indicates the RAM they did install or the motherboard are bad which will set me back another $300-600 to repair.
This is the most dishonest company I have ever dealt with in my life and a company that should be avoided at all cost.
